> At the moment, most of the tabs on DAG detail page has the *Base date* feature which behaves only for that particular tab/view. From end-user's perspective it is confusing as a user assume to select a date and then see all views based on that date
> The idea is to move the *Base date* outside the tabs, and each tab will then behave on the *Base date* on the Global level. Users will then only need to select the base date once and every tab will behave on that date. 
> Please see attached screenshot for reference
> Or, the second approach could be to make sure the change of Base Date in each tab remains the same and doesn't change on page refresh.
